Transaction e7e52cb539517a859668f2e9b848b7a51052d0948553f3ac22a46bb57d815c94

3 Input
1 Outputs
  • e7e52cb539517a859668f2e9b848b7a51052d0948553f3ac22a46bb57d815c94:0
  • value  20358829
    address  39uvxoJGuZ6qQW99Kp4cjpaYyfgVipcrXx